Sinterklaas is a celebration that they have on Dec. 5th in Holland. Santa Clause is becoming more popular but Sinterklaas is the traditional celebration. At the end of November Sinterklaas and his zwarte pieten (black helpers) arrive in every town by boat then they have a parade and at the end the mayor hands over the keys to the town hall to Sinterklaas and he officially runs the town till Dec. 5th. Dutch parents, like American parents, also use the gifts of Sinterklaas to bribe their kids into behavig well. One of my teachers, who has 3 kids, invited us to his house the day that Sinterklaas arrived and we went with his family to watch the arrival and celebration.
